Embracing the Mini Bike Manual Clutch

While a mini bike manual clutch may appear daunting for beginners it is a component that enhances the overall riding experience. Here’s what it offers;

Complete Control:

A manual clutch for bikes grants riders complete control, over gear shifts. By changing gears riders can manage speed and torque effectively ensuring a personalized riding experience based on terrain and skill level.

Enhanced Learning Opportunities:

For aspiring motor enthusiasts learning with a clutch provides skills that can be applied to various types of motorcycles.

It offers insights, into the dynamics of the engine. Creates a bond between the rider and the bike.
